Mogut — App Store Growth MCP

mogut_discover_profiles

Lists all profiles in the App Store Growth MCP server, showing whether each is loaded and the tools it contains. Use this to locate the right ASO and growth intelligence tools for your analysis.

Instructions

Lists every profile, whether it is loaded, and the tools it contains.
